When downloading mp3´s in dc++ I have always be annoyed over that I have to download a song to check what quality it has.

Woulden´t it be a great feature if dc++ could sence if the mp3 file that Im about to download is a 92 kbps encoding or a 192 kbps encoding.

Best would be If it could show this right next to filename in searchlist.

Post by PseudonympH » 2004-08-31 14:04

Not realistically possible within the NMDC protocol (just adding TTH was an ugly kluge as it is). It's possible under ADC, but I think features like this should be left in modland.
